Description

30 Everett St sits in Boston, at the intersection of Bennington Street and Saratoga Street. It stands just a short distance from the Boston Harbor. This low-rise building has 2 stories and consists of 6 condominium units. Construction was completed in 1899, giving it a historic touch. The units range in size from 1,247 to 1,389 square feet, each with two bedrooms. Prices start at $410,000. This price point reflects the area and the type of living space. With modern living in mind, these units provide comfort and style. Nearby amenities enhance the location. Residents can enjoy public transportation, parks, and tennis courts. The East Boston Kitchen provides a local dining option for meals out, while Sumner Market takes care of grocery needs. Schools such as the City of Boston Kindergarten serve families with children. The property is close to several outdoor spaces, making it appealing for active lifestyles. Boston Harbor offers opportunities for various activities, while parks nearby invite relaxation and recreation. This balance of nature and urban living creates a vibrant community atmosphere. Parking is available for residents, adding to the convenience. The building maintains a low-rise feel, blending well with the surrounding neighborhood. With its prime location and essential amenities, 30 Everett St holds great potential for comfortable living in Boston.

The Neighbourhood: East Boston

East Boston is a waterfront neighborhood by Logan Airport. The area has parks, a harborwalk, wide green spaces, and playgrounds. This district hosts many cafes, casual restaurants, local shops, and small markets. The area has public schools, a town center, a community center, and health clinics. Ferries run to downtown, buses use main routes, and drivers reach the highway quickly. Cyclists find marked bike lanes, and short rides link to central Boston and the airport by transit. Local markets sell fresh food, and seasonal farmers markets appear on weekends.

30 Everett St Demographics

This neighborhood indicates a good mix of people which makes it a good place for families. About 14.19% are children aged 0–14, 27.09% are young adults between 15–29, 29.98% are adults aged 30–44, 17.11% are in the 45–59 range and 11.62% are seniors aged 60 and above. Commuting options are also varying where 39.09% of residents relying on public transit, while others prefer walking around 17.94%, driving around 27.06%, biking around 0.88%, allowing residents to choose travel modes that best fit their daily routines. Most homes in the area are with 76.54% of units are rented and 23.46% are owner occupied. The neighborhood offers different household types. About 21.17% are single family homes and 6.44% are multi family units. Around 38.55% are single-person households, while 61.45% are multi person households. This mix works well for families, roommates, and individuals. Education levels in the neighborhood vary widely where 30.49% of residents have bachelor’s degrees. Around 17.57% have high school or college education. Another 3.24% hold diplomas while 19.34% have completed postgraduate studies. The remaining are 29.36% with other types of qualifications.
